Summary
Volkswagen
Group of America, Inc. (Audi
) is recalling certain 2019-2021 Audi
A8 and 2020-2021 Audi
S8 vehicles. A missing sealing pin may allow moisture to enter the engine control module connector, possibly causing a control module malfunction.

Check if your Audi has a Recall
Issue:
Due to a deviation in the manufacturing process of the wiring harness supplier, a sealing pin may be missing in one of the engine control unit connectors. Moisture may enter the connector of the engine control module due to a missing sealing pin. This may cause malfunctions accompanied by illumination of the Malfunction Indicator Lamp (MIL) and the engine may go into fail-safe mode with restricted RPM. It cannot completely be ruled out that the engine may stop while driving. If the engine stops while the vehicle is in motion especially at higher speeds, this may increase the risk of a crash.
Repair:
- REPAIR AVAILABLE – March 04, 2021 – Inspect the connector on the engine control unit to see if the sealing pin is present. If missing, the pin will be installed. The connector will also be checked for possibly existing corrosion and – if necessary – the affected connections will be replaced.See ELSA/ServiceNet for complete repair & claiming instructions

Section B – Repair Procedure
Prepare Puller – Windshield Wiper -T40394-:
• Turn the bolt <3> all the way upward.
• Push the locking ring <4> upward in direction of .
• Remove the hook <1> and pivot the second hook <2> to the side.
Removing wiper arms:
Vehicles without integrated washer nozzles:
NOTE
If the windshield wiper motor is to be run during the work procedure, the hood must be closed. Otherwise, the power supply to the wiper motor will be interrupted.
• Mark the current wiper position with a piece of masking tape.
NOTE
Marking the original position of the wiper arms should prevent the need for adjusting the wiper arms after reinstalling.
• Pry the caps off of the windshield wiper arms <1> with a screwdriver.
• Remove the nuts <2>.

Remove service cover (vehicles with integrated washer nozzles only):
NOTE
If the windshield wiper motor is to be run during the work procedure, the hood must be closed. Otherwise, the power supply to the wiper motor will be interrupted.
• Slide the service cover <1> for the plenum chamber cover toward the rear in direction of and remove it.
Vehicles with integrated washer nozzles:
• Mark the current wiper position with a piece of masking tape.
NOTE
Marking the original position of the wiper arms should prevent the need for adjusting the wiper arms after reinstalling.
• Disconnect the connector <1>.
• Release the retainers and disconnect the washer fluid hoses <2 and 3> at the connection points.
• Free up the grommet <5> and the washer fluid hoses <6> with the connector at the plenum chamber cover.
• Release the side retainer and pivot the cover <4> upward.

Vehicles with integrated washer nozzles:
• Push the washer fluid hoses <3> slightly to the side.
• Using a screwdriver, pry the cap out of the windshield wiper arm <1>.
• Remove the nut <2>.
Removing wiper arms (cont. for all vehicles):
• Position the hook <2> on the windshield wiper arm <1>.
• Position the -T40394- on the opposite side of the windshield wiper arm and latch the pivoting hook <3>.
• Push the locking ring <4> downward in direction of .
• Turn the bolt <5> clockwise until the windshield wiper arm is removed from the windshield wiper axle.
• Remove the windshield wiper arms.

Remove plenum chamber cover:
• Remove gasket <2>.
• Coat the transition between the frame <3> and the plenum chamber cover <1> with soapy water.
• Remove the plenum chamber cover from the window edge vertically upward starting from the frame on the windshield .
Inspect ECM and T56f connector:
• Turn off ignition.
• Disconnect T56f connector .
NOTE
If the sealing pin was missing from position 19 (T56f/19), it’s possible that moisture entered the ECM connector and caused corrosion.
• Check ECM pins and T56f connector for corrosion.
• If corrosion is found:
o A new sealing pin must be installed in the T56f connector.
o The ECM must be replaced.
o Any corroded pins in the T56/f connector must be replaced.
• If no corrosion is found:
o A new sealing pin must be installed in the T56f connector.

Installing sealing pin:
• Remove connector lock and install new sealing pin into chamber 19 (T56f/19).
• Reinstall connector lock.
• Reconnect T56f connector to ECM.
Reassemble vehicle:
• Reassembly is the reverse order of removal.
• When installing plenum chamber cover, DO NOT strike cover with fist or other tools. Doing so could break the windshield.
• Reference previously made tape reference when installing the wiper arms.
• Pay attention to the different lengths of the wiper blades for the driver and front passenger side.
• Torque wiper arm nuts to 32 Nm.
